For announcement lists[0], being able to do handle subscriptions,
unsubscriptions and bounce handling via Mailman is a plus, since
it (in my organization) is already used for "normal" mailing lists for
internal and external use. 

Many customers, who normally only use the net for web and mail, would
prefer a mail being sent from Customer Service, and addressed to their
own address, so that they know the mail was sent to them, and that they
can hit reply to get help.

I would certainly prefer that, since a not insignificant fraction of the
users usually hits "reply to all" anyway.  This creates a lot of
unneccesary noise on the moderator interface.

Yes, that same functionality could be used to spam, but in most cases it
won't.  Mailman is simply not efficient enough for that purpose. The
spammers use hundreds of thousands of worm-infected computers today, to
spread messages.

I guess many of my problems could be solved by combining mailman
options, but I'd like a "this is an announcement list" option, that does
all this for me.

[0] Information about planned outages, unplanned outages, etc...
